3. U743 tuner replacement.
The U743 UHF tuner has been replaced by the U943. In all applications it is a direct replacement. Where the substitution was made
during production some components, being no longer required, were deleted at the same time. This means that in some chassis the
tuners are not reverse compatible ie. a U743 cannot be fitted in place of a U943 without first refitting components concerned with the
+12V supply to pin 10 of the U743 tuner. The list of changes are as follows:

12. Page header suppression. Since the BBC changed the CEEFAX format, receivers with fastext will display the page header
continuously when the set is in subtitle mode (page 888). The problem is only observed on BBC recorded programmes with subtitles
(subtitles on live programmes, and on independent television are not affected). The BBC have agreed to suppress the header on future
recorded subtitled programmes. However, many programmes are already "in the can" and could be transmitted at any time with the
page header not suppressed. To accommodate this, the teletext microcomputer MAB8461P/W107 has been reprogrammed to suppress
the page header when subtitles are being received. The new version (MAB8461P/W196) is available from service under code no. 4822
209 62479. In cases of specific complaint the new version may be fitted as a drop-in replacement.

14. Safety test after repair.
Note: Due to defective components in an appliance (capacitors etc.) parts of the appliance can become charged. This cannot be
established when an appliance is tested on an isoformer. For safety reasons the appliance must also be connected to a non separated
socket and then checked that touchable parts (aerial, external connections etc.) are not charged.

20. Testing the power supply.
Note 1: Remove connector M6 and connect a 60W light bulb across C2696 and monitor the DC voltage. Apply Mains via a variac, the
bulb should light when the DC voltage is about 70V and it should stabilise at 95V. If the voltage does not stabilise then check the
components around the optocoupler CNX62 and set the HT control to 95V.

16. Brightness level change in A/V mode. Fault 1: It is possible that some video equipment will provide a CVBS signal slightly in
excess of the 1 volt peak-to-peak level required. This will cause a change in brightness level when switching between external A/V
mode and the RF signal which some viewers may find objectionable. The phenomena can be reduced by attenuating the CVBS input as
follows : Replace link 9506 with an 18R resistor Change R3525 from 75R to 56R.
Note: This change will not be introduced into production but may be applied in cases of specific complaint only.

3If the set is switched off when warm it won't come on again until it has cooled down. By using the remote control unit it switches off
but not to standby, only a slight whistle being heard. Fault 1 A likely cause of this fault is failure of the 680KR resistor R3661. Replace
it and check carefully for dry joints in the power supply section, particularly on the pins of the chopper transformer T5763.
